Burr Mechanism & Grind Consistency

The metallic flat burr crushes beans between two abrasive surfaces rather than chopping them. The result is a much narrower particle size distribution, which means more even extraction and noticeably sweeter, less bitter coffee. Side by side with a blade grinder on the same beans, the difference is obvious in the cup.

The 16 Settings in Practice

Settings 1 through 4 produce espresso-adjacent grinds that work for stovetop moka pots but not true 9-bar espresso machines. Settings 5 through 9 are the sweet spot for pour over and drip. Settings 10 through 16 cover French press and cold brew territory.

The CEVING Mini Manual Coffee Grinder is the only hand-crank option in this roundup, and it earns its place by offering something no electric grinder under fifty dollars can match: a ceramic conical burr with 40 grind settings in a package that fits in a backpack and weighs less than a can of soup.

Manual grinders are the secret weapon of the budget coffee world. The ceramic burr stays sharp longer than steel, generates less heat that would otherwise toast volatile aromatics, and the conical shape produces a tighter particle distribution than any blade grinder on this list.

40 External Grind Settings

Forty settings is more adjustability than any other grinder in this roundup, including the electric burr options. Each click is tactile and numbered on the adjustment dial, so you can return to a known grind size for your favorite brew method. I dialed in setting 18 for AeroPress and never had to second-guess it.

Ceramic Burr & Flavor Preservation

The ceramic conical burr crushes beans rather than chopping them, and ceramic transfers almost no heat to the grounds during grinding. That means more of the delicate aromatics stay in your cup instead of volatizing away. The difference is most obvious with lighter single-origin beans.

Buying Guide: How to Choose the Right Coffee Grinder Under $50

Picking the right grinder is more important than picking the right coffee maker. Once beans are ground, the surface area exposed to air multiplies by a factor of a hundred or more, and freshness collapses within hours. A mediocre grinder with great beans will taste worse than a good grinder with average beans. Here is how to choose under fifty dollars.

Blade vs Burr: The Single Most Important Decision

Blade grinders chop beans with a spinning propeller, producing a mix of dust and large chunks in every batch. Burr grinders crush beans between two abrasive surfaces, producing a far more uniform particle size. Uniform particles extract evenly, which means sweeter coffee with no harsh bitterness or sour under-extraction. If you can spend forty dollars, buy a burr grinder. If you cannot, a blade grinder is still vastly better than pre-ground coffee.

Electric vs Manual: Trade-offs at the Budget Tier

Electric grinders are fast and effortless but typically use blades at this price. Manual grinders use better burrs, cost less, and never break down electrically, but they require 30 to 60 seconds of cranking per cup. If you make one or two cups at a time and value consistency over speed, a manual grinder like the CEVING will outperform any electric blade grinder on this list for taste.

Grind Size for Your Brewing Method

Espresso needs a fine powder-like grind. AeroPress and pour over want a medium-fine texture resembling table salt. Drip coffee works best at medium, similar to beach sand. French press and cold brew need a coarse grind like raw sugar. Match your grinder’s range to your primary brewing method before buying, because a blade grinder simply cannot produce the uniform fine grind espresso demands.

Capacity, Noise, and Cleaning

Capacity matters most for households of three or more. Look for at least 3 ounces if you brew full pots. Noise is rarely advertised but matters in apartments and offices; the BLACK+DECKER and Hamilton Beach were the quietest blade grinders in our tests. For cleaning, removable dishwasher-safe bowls like the Hamilton Beach are the gold standard, and burr grinders with removable top burrs are far easier to maintain than fixed-chamber designs. Durability, Warranty, and Real Lifespan

Most blade grinders in this price tier last 3 to 5 years of daily use. Burr grinders tend to last longer because the burrs themselves are replaceable in some models, but budget burr grinders like the SHARDOR and KRUPS do carry a slightly higher rate of 1-star reviews citing reliability issues. Look for the longest warranty available: Cuisinart offers 18 months, BLACK+DECKER and SHARDOR offer 2 years, and most others offer 1 year.

What’s the difference between blade and burr grinders?

Blade grinders use a spinning propeller blade to chop beans, producing uneven particle sizes with dust and chunks mixed together. Burr grinders crush beans between two abrasive surfaces, producing a far more uniform particle size. Uniform particles extract evenly, resulting in sweeter, more balanced coffee. Burr grinders are always recommended over blade grinders for flavor quality.

Can you get a good espresso grinder for under $50?

You cannot get a true espresso grinder for under $50. Real espresso requires a very fine, highly uniform grind at 9 bars of pressure that no sub-$50 electric grinder can produce. For stovetop moka pots and AeroPress, the SHARDOR Electric Burr 2.0 with 16 settings is your best bet. For traditional espresso machines, plan to spend $150 or more.
